Dry heat sterilization is an essential method used to sterilize materials that can withstand high temperatures without being damaged. It relies on the transfer of heat to microorganisms, denaturing their proteins, and ultimately leading to their destruction.

When evaluating the provided temperature options for a 2-hour dry heat sterilization cycle, 320 degrees Fahrenheit is the standard operating temperature for such a process. At this temperature, materials can be effectively sterilized in a time frame designated by professionals in the field.

This specific temperature is commonly used in practices involving sterilization of glassware, metal instruments, and other heat-stable items. The effectiveness of dry heat sterilization at this temperature helps ensure that all forms of microbial life, including spores, are eradicated. Understanding the appropriate temperature and duration is crucial for effective sterilization practices in a clinical setting.
